- The distance between Temple, Tx, Usa and La Paz, Bolivia is approximately 6,143 km or 3,817 mi.
- To reach Temple, Tx in this distance one would set out from La Paz bearing 329.5°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Temple, Tx bearing 325.3° or NW .
- Temple, Tx has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as La Paz has a tundra climate (ET).
- Temple, Tx is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ome whereas La Paz is in or near the polar desert biome.
- The average temperature is 11.5 °C (20.6°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 17.5 °C (31.5°F) more in Temple, Tx.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 321.8 mm (12.7 in) more which is equivalent to 321.8 l/m² (7.9 US gal/ft²) or 3,218,000 l/ha (344,026 US gal/ac) more. About 1 4/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 11.3° lower in Temple, Tx than in La Paz.
